E30 Idle speed troubleshooting

Hi pelican, Ive got an 89 325is. Once the car gets up to temp it surges randomly when idling, and the throttle sticks open slightly when i clutch in. Would this be a sticky idle control valve or a bad throttle switch?

Likely the idle control valve, but make sure that your throttle linkages are free to move.

Page 27 of section 6 Bentley gives 6 items to check. With me its always a vacuum leak. A new valve cover gasket & tighten all the hose clamps may fix it.
